The Benefits of Dental Implants



Are you taking into consideration oral implants for replacing missing teeth and improving your smile? Well, you're in luck because oral implants provide a wide range of advantages.



Most importantly, they provide an irreversible service to missing out on teeth. Unlike dentures or bridges, dental implants are surgically placed into the jawbone, which suggests they're incredibly steady and won't change or move. This enables you to eat, talk, and smile with confidence without stressing over your teeth eloping.

Furthermore, oral implants look just like all-natural teeth, providing you a seamless and natural-looking smile. They likewise aid to maintain the integrity of your jawbone by boosting bone growth, stopping bone loss that can accompany missing out on teeth.

Possible Disadvantages of Dental Implants



While oral implants offer many advantages, there are a couple of potential disadvantages you should consider before choosing. Here are 3 essential indicate bear in mind:

1. Expense: Oral implants can be quite expensive compared to other tooth substitute alternatives. The treatment itself calls for extensive planning and numerous visits, which can add up the general cost. In addition, most oral insurance coverage plans don't cover the complete expense of oral implants, leaving you to pay of pocket.

2. Recovery time: The procedure of obtaining oral implants includes oral surgery, which indicates there will be a healing period. It can take a number of months for the implant to fully incorporate with the jawbone. During this time, you might experience pain, swelling, and the requirement to modify your diet plan till the dental implant is completely healed.
